MBD - STEP AP242 EXPORT
In addition to Onshape sharing and Publication capabilities for downstream stakeholders, Onshape MBD also supports exporting as STEP AP242. The AP242 format can include 3D PMI data for direct read into inspection software and tools, CMM programming, and more. 
Below shows an example file, exported from Onshape, which has been imported into Creo while retaining all defined 3D PMI.

REPLICATE ASSEMBLY SECTION-VIEW IN IN-CONTEXT PART STUDIO
Now when choosing to edit in context from an assembly with an active section view, the display of the section will be carried over to the Part Studio for In-context modeling. Likewise, when using the Go to assembly button from the active context, the orientation, zoom level, and display will be preserved when returning to the assembly. TRANSFER APPLICATION OWNERSHIP
Administrators can now transfer ownership of custom applications to other users, Companies, or Enterprises. This improvement simplifies application management when team members change roles or leave, ensuring continuity and control over custom-built integrations without recreating them from scratch.

IMPROVED CUTTING SELECTION ARROWS
Onshape CAM Studio introduces enhanced selection arrows for contouring operations to improve user experience and programming confidence. The update adds a new cutting side arrow that works alongside the existing cutting direction arrow, automatically adjusting for climb or conventional milling modes. When users change the tool hand from right to left or vice versa, both direction arrows automatically update to maintain accuracy while reflecting the correct cutting side. These improvements provide clearer visual feedback and give users greater confidence when programming CAM operations.

SUPPORT FOR SCHEDULED ASSIGNMENTS
Educators can now schedule assignments in advance. On the assignment details page, educators can opt into scheduling to set a publish and/or close date. When the publish date and time are reached, the assignment will go live and move to an “In progress” state. Likewise, they can provide a date for when the assignment will be set to a “Closed” state. When the assignment is moved to a “Closed” state, students will no longer be able to submit from their assignments list.

I've answered @eric_pesty in the ticket. We don't have tolerant dimension abilities on just length dimensions on a singular edge, which would be a singular face. For semantic reasons on ensuring that we are passing down clean data to inspection systems , we only map length dimensions to two faces, or in sketches - edges that would "beget" faces in prismatic operations.
Perhaps an easier way to think about it. For length dimensions, how would you measure that with your calipers/micrometers. Yes, then dimension it the same way. Put on your inspectors hat, and we'll also improve this scenario within reason. We're not perfect yet, and you'll see that too. But we will improve.
The dimensions have to be a line-to-line or face to face dimension - not a singluar edge or face
